Letters Bush's comeback
This is with reference to the editorial Bush is back (Business Line, November 5). By winning the Presidential elections for the second consecutive time, Mr Bush is back at the helm of affairs once again with a bang. That he has managed to win comfortably against Senator John Kerry, despite palpable dissatisfaction across the globe against him hardly matters, since the people of America have reposed faith in him. For the rest of the world, it is going to be a different ball game. They have to concede to whatever Mr Bush decides from now on, or else face the consequences simply because of the fact that America, always calls the shots. K.
